About This Item
Limited edition, published by Constable in 2012 to commemorate the hundred-year anniversary of the author's death.
Limited to 1,000 copies with a new introduction by Colm Toibin, each of which is a facsimile of the first edition published by Archibald Constable in 1897, and contains a never-before-seen copy of the original contract between Bram Stoker and his publisher.
Original yellow cloth with lettering to spine and upper board in red. A fine copy, housed in a fine red cloth slipcase. The original box in which the book was issued is also included.

Synopsis
Dracula is a gothic horror book written by Bram Stoker and published in 1897. The story is told through a series of journal entries, letters, and newspaper articles, and it follows the efforts of a group of people led by Professor Abraham Van Helsing to defeat the vampire Count Dracula. Dracula by Bram Stoker has been attributed to many literary genres including vampire literature, horror fiction, the gothic novel, and invasion literature. It has become a cultural icon, spawning countless adaptations in film, television, and other media. The novel's depiction of the struggle between good and evil continues to captivate readers today.
